开源管理工具如何助力敏捷团队协作?

在当今快节奏、高竞争的市场环境中,敏捷团队已成为许多企业追求高效协作和快速响应市场变化的关键。而开源管理工具作为一种灵活、可定制、成本效益高的解决方案,正助力敏捷团队实现高效协作。本文将探讨开源管理工具如何助力敏捷团队协作,并分析其在项目管理、沟通协作、持续集成与持续部署等方面的优势。

一、项目管理

  1. 敏捷项目管理工具

敏捷团队在进行项目管理时,通常采用看板(Kanban)、Scrum等敏捷方法。开源管理工具如Jira、Trello等,为敏捷团队提供了丰富的项目管理功能。

(1)看板管理:Jira、Trello等工具支持看板功能,敏捷团队可以根据项目需求创建不同的看板,将任务按照进度分为“待办”、“进行中”、“已完成”等状态,实时跟踪任务进度。

(2)Scrum管理:Jira等工具支持Scrum管理,可以帮助敏捷团队进行产品迭代、团队协作、角色分配等工作。


  1. 项目进度跟踪

开源管理工具具备良好的项目进度跟踪功能,如甘特图、里程碑等,有助于敏捷团队掌握项目整体进度,及时调整计划。

二、沟通协作

  1. 在线沟通

开源管理工具如Slack、Microsoft Teams等,为敏捷团队提供了便捷的在线沟通平台。团队成员可以通过文字、语音、视频等多种方式进行实时沟通,提高协作效率。


  1. 文档共享与协作

开源文档编辑工具如Google Docs、Confluence等,支持多人实时编辑文档,有助于敏捷团队共享知识、协同工作。


  1. 任务分配与跟踪

开源管理工具如Jira、Trello等,支持任务分配与跟踪功能,团队成员可以清晰地了解自己的工作内容、进度和责任人,提高协作效率。

三、持续集成与持续部署

  1. 持续集成(CI)

开源CI工具如Jenkins、Travis CI等,可以帮助敏捷团队实现自动化构建、测试和部署。通过持续集成,团队成员可以及时发现并解决代码冲突,提高代码质量。


  1. 持续部署(CD)

开源CD工具如Docker、Kubernetes等,支持自动化部署和扩展应用程序。敏捷团队可以利用这些工具实现快速、稳定的持续部署,提高产品上线速度。

四、开源管理工具的优势

  1. 成本效益高

开源管理工具通常免费或价格低廉,相比商业软件,具有更高的成本效益。


  1. 灵活可定制

开源管理工具可以根据团队需求进行定制,满足不同项目的管理需求。


  1. 社区支持

开源项目拥有庞大的社区,团队成员可以随时获取技术支持、分享经验,提高团队协作效率。


  1. 生态丰富

开源管理工具与其他开源软件具有良好的兼容性,可以构建完整的生态系统,满足敏捷团队在项目管理、沟通协作、持续集成与持续部署等方面的需求。

五、总结

开源管理工具为敏捷团队提供了丰富的功能,助力团队实现高效协作。在项目管理、沟通协作、持续集成与持续部署等方面,开源管理工具发挥着重要作用。随着开源生态的不断发展,开源管理工具将继续为敏捷团队提供更多价值,助力企业实现敏捷转型。

猜你喜欢:IT项目管理系统